Nations debate easing lockdown as hardship grows

  • Public health experts say that wider testing is essential to prevent the virus from coming back

BERLIN: As unemployment rises many around the world, governments are wrestling with when and how to ease restrictions designed to control the coronavirus pandemic.

Mandatory lockdowns to stop the spread of the new virus, which has so far infected more than 2.2 million people and for which there is no vaccine, have brought widespread hardship.
In a joint statement Saturday, a group of 13 countries including Canada, Brazil, Italy and Germany called for global cooperation to lessen the economic impact of the pandemic.
“It is vital that we work together to save lives and livelihoods,” they said. The group, which includes Britain, France Indonesia, Mexico, Morocco, Peru, South Korea, Singapore and Turkey, said it was committed to “work with all countries to coordinate on public health, travel, trade, economic and financial measures in order to minimize disruptions and recover stronger.”
The countries emphasized the need to maintain “air, land and marine transportation links” to ensure the continued flow of goods including medical equipment and aid, and the return of travelers.
In the US, the debate has taken on partisan tones ahead of this fall’s presidential elections. Republican President Donald Trump urged supporters to “liberate” three states led by Democratic governors, tweeting the kind of rhetoric some have used to demand an end to stay-at-home orders that have thrown millions out of work.
Most governments remain cautious, even as the economic toll rises. Public health experts warn that easing shutdowns must be accompanied by wider testing and tracing of infected people to keep the virus from coming back.
Singapore, which has been held up as a model for other nations after taking strong measures to clamp down on the virus, reported a new daily record of 942 infections Saturday that brought its total to 5,992.
The number of cases in the city-state has more than doubled just this week alone amid an explosion of cases among foreign workers staying in crowded dormitories, that now make up 60 percent of Singapore’s infections.
Japan also reported a surge of 556 new cases Saturday, pushing its total to more than 10,000. Prime Minister Shinzo Abe expressed concern on Friday that people were not observing social distancing and announced a 100,000-yen ($930) cash handout to each resident as an incentive to stay home.
In Africa, the pandemic is only just getting underway. The continent now has more than 1,000 coronavirus deaths, according to the Africa Centers for Disease Control and Prevention. Fifty-two of the continent’s 54 countries have reported the virus, with the total number of cases more than 19,800 as of Saturday morning.

8% - France has warned its economy could shrink 8 percent this year. leading to its worst recession since World War II.

Top leaders of China’s ruling Communist Party called for deficit spending and a more flexible monetary policy after the economy shrank 6.8 percent in the first three months of the year.
France’s lower house of parliament approved an emergency budget that takes into account the government’s €110 billion ($120 billion) plan to save the economy from collapse. The government has warned that France’s economy, one of the world’s biggest, could shrink 8 percent this year and suffer its worst recession since World War II.
South Korea’s Health Minister Kim Gang-lip said on Saturday that new guidelines could be issued that officials have said would allow people to engage in “certain levels of economic and social activity.”
The East Asian country was among the 13 nations to issue the joint statement on protecting global trade. The declaration also stressed “the importance and critical role of the scientific community in providing guidance to governments,” and suggested pooling scientific resources and efforts to tackle the pandemic.
While most of those sickened by the virus recover, the outbreak has killed at least 155,000 people worldwide, according to a Johns Hopkins University tally.
The number very likely underestimates the actual toll. Authorities said that almost everywhere, thousands have died with COVID-19 symptoms — many in nursing homes — without being tested for the virus, and have gone uncounted. In Britain, with an official count of about 14,600 dead, the country’s statistics agency said the real number could be 15 percent higher.

Using space science to protect Saudi Arabia’s environment

  • Kingdom is harnessing satellite technology to forecast disasters, boost agriculture

RIYADH: Learning space science has delivered significant environmental benefits worldwide, helping many countries better understand and manage climate challenges. 

Saudi Arabia is now taking steps not only to explore the galaxy but also to invest in future generations who can apply space science to pressing environmental issues at home.

Last November, the Space Academy, part of the Saudi Space Agency, launched a series of seminars designed to enhance knowledge and develop skills in space science and technology, with a particular focus on Earth observation.

Running for nearly a month, the program formed part of a broader strategy to nurture national talent, raise scientific awareness, and build data capabilities that support innovation and research across the Kingdom.

As efforts to strengthen the sector continue, important questions remain: How can space science translate into tangible environmental benefits? And how large is the global space economy?

In an interview with Arab News, Fahad Alhussain, co-founder of SeedFord, highlighted the scale of the opportunity and its environmental impact.

“To be frank, the slogan that we always use in space is that ‘saving the Earth from the space.’ It is all about this,” Alhusain told Arab News.

“You can recall a lot of related environmental issues like global warming, related to forests, related to the damage that happens to the environment. Without space, it would be almost impossible to see the magnitude of these damages.”

According to Alhussain, satellites have transformed how experts observe environmental changes on Earth, offering a comprehensive view that was previously impossible.

“By collecting data and using satellites… You can better analyze and measure so many things that help the environment,” said Fahad Alhussain. (Supplied)

He said that “the transformation of technology allows even the non-optical ways of measuring, assessing, and discovering what is going on in the environment … you can even anticipate fire before it happens in the forest.”

“You can detect the ice-melt down, you can get huge amount of information and can see it through the weather maps…there is a huge section in the economy for the environment,” Alhussain commented.

A 2022 report by Ryan Brukardt, a senior partner at McKinsey & Company, published by McKinsey Quarterly, found that more than 160 satellites currently monitor Earth to assess the impacts of global warming and detect activities such as illegal logging.

Brukardt cited NASA as an example of how advanced satellite tools are used to track environmental changes, including shifts in ocean conditions, cloud cover, and precipitation patterns. He also noted that satellite data can help governments determine when immediate action is needed, particularly in response to wildfires.

Beyond disaster response, satellites offer vital insights for agriculture. According to Brukardt’s report, scientists can use space-based data to monitor crop development and anticipate threats to harvests, such as drought or insect infestations.

These wide-ranging applications explain the rapid growth of the global space economy. 

According to World Economic Forum research, the sector is projected to reach $1.8 trillion by 2035, nearly tripling from $630 billion in 2023.

A deeper understanding of space and its applications offers Saudi Arabia, and the world, better tools to anticipate climate challenges, protect ecosystems, and safeguard biodiversity. (Supplied)

For Saudi Arabia, expanding space science capabilities could help address the country’s arid conditions by monitoring desertification and identifying sources of air pollution. Early detection of droughts, heatwaves, and crop stress could support more effective environmental planning and response.

Space-based data could also play a critical role in tracking environmental changes in the Red Sea and surrounding coastal ecosystems, strengthening marine conservation efforts and supporting the Sustainable Development Agenda.

As Alhussain emphasized, advancing knowledge in space science and satellite technology enables experts to measure environmental damage accurately and predict disasters before they occur, allowing for more effective responses.

By investing in space science education and research, the Kingdom can build national expertise, strengthen environmental protection policies, enhance food and water security, and contribute to global efforts to combat climate change—while also benefiting from the rapidly expanding space economy.

Ultimately, a deeper understanding of space and its applications offers Saudi Arabia, and the world, better tools to anticipate climate challenges, protect ecosystems, and safeguard biodiversity.
